The Morel Life Cycle: A Symbiotic Dance

Morel growth is not a simple process. It involves a fascinating interaction between the fungus and its environment, particularly the surrounding trees. The life cycle can be broadly divided into the following stages:

  • Spore Dispersal: Morels reproduce through spores released from the pits of their caps. These microscopic spores are dispersed by wind, water, and animals.
  • Germination and Mycelial Network: When a spore lands in a suitable environment, it germinates, forming thread-like structures called hyphae. These hyphae intertwine and fuse to create a network known as mycelium. This mycelium is the vegetative part of the fungus.
  • Sclerotia Formation (Optional): Some species of morels form sclerotia, hardened masses of mycelium that serve as a survival mechanism during unfavorable conditions. These sclerotia can later develop into new mycelial networks.
  • Fruiting Body Formation: Under specific environmental conditions (often triggered by changes in temperature and moisture), the mycelium develops fruiting bodies – the morel mushrooms we recognize. This is where the ascocarps appear.
  • Spore Release and Cycle Continuation: Once mature, the fruiting bodies release spores, continuing the life cycle.

The Elusive Symbiotic Relationship

The relationship between morels and trees is complex and not fully understood. While some believe morels are saprophytic (decomposing organic matter), others argue for a symbiotic, possibly mycorrhizal, relationship with trees. It’s likely that morels can exhibit both behaviors.

  • Trees as Partners: Some theories suggest that morels benefit from the nutrients provided by the roots of certain trees, such as ash, elm, and apple. The tree may also receive benefits in return, such as enhanced nutrient uptake.
  • Decomposition and Nutrient Cycling: Morels may also obtain nutrients by breaking down decaying organic matter in the soil, contributing to nutrient cycling in the ecosystem.
  • Environmental Triggers: The specific tree species and soil conditions in a particular area can significantly influence morel growth and abundance.

The Secret Ingredients: Environmental Factors

Beyond a symbiotic relationship, morel growth hinges on several crucial environmental factors:

  • Moisture: Adequate soil moisture is essential for spore germination and mycelial growth. Spring rains are often a prerequisite for a good morel season.
  • Temperature: Soil temperature plays a critical role in fruiting body formation. Morels typically appear when soil temperatures reach a certain threshold, often between 50°F and 60°F (10°C and 15°C).
  • Soil Type: Morels are often found in well-drained soils rich in organic matter. The specific soil composition can vary depending on the morel species and the surrounding habitat.
  • Light: While morels don’t require direct sunlight, dappled shade is often preferred. The amount of light can influence soil temperature and moisture levels.

Understanding Morel Species

The term “morel” encompasses several species, each with its own unique characteristics and habitat preferences. Understanding these differences can aid in identification and foraging success.

SpeciesAppearanceHabitatNotes
Morchella esculentaYellow morel, honeycomb capUnder ash, elm, and apple treesHighly prized for its flavor
Morchella elataBlack morel, darker cap with ridgesBurn sites, disturbed areasOften appears after forest fires
Morchella angusticepsNarrow black morel, elongated capConiferous forests, especially under pinesDistinctly narrow cap shape
Morchella rufobrunneaLandscape morel, reddish-brown capWood chip beds, landscaped areasFrequently found in urban environments

What is sclerotia, and what role does it play in morel growth?

Sclerotia are hardened masses of mycelium that some morel species form as a survival mechanism. They act as a reservoir of nutrients and can withstand unfavorable conditions such as drought or extreme temperatures. When conditions improve, the sclerotia can germinate and produce new mycelial networks, eventually leading to the formation of morel mushrooms.

What role does fire play in morel growth?

Some morel species, particularly black morels (Morchella elata), are known to fruit prolifically in burn sites after forest fires. The fire likely releases nutrients into the soil, reduces competition from other fungi, and creates favorable conditions for mycelial growth. This phenomenon is not fully understood, but it highlights the complex relationship between morels and their environment.

How do you identify a false morel, and why is it important to distinguish them from true morels?

False morels have a brain-like or saddle-shaped cap that is often attached to the stem only at the top, whereas true morels have a honeycomb-like cap that is fully attached to the stem. It’s crucial to distinguish them because some false morels contain gyromitrin, a toxic compound that can cause illness or even death. Proper identification is essential for safe morel hunting.
